Very long process. But people are very nice. Talked to HR first to discuss benefits. Then talk to a VP, then a ED, then 2 directors, then the hiring manager. The last talked to 2 future team members.

There were two interviews. One with recruiter to go over resume and why I was interested in the job. Second interview was with hiring manager and there was a series of behavioral questions. Hiring manager and lead were very polite.
